The Global History of Capitalism project's Career Development Fellow, Dr Andrew Edwards has published a new blog post Time and the Economic as part of a Past & Present series on Political Economy and Culture in Global History, which came out of a reading group /discussion project convened by Andrew Edwards, with Peter Hill (Northumbria University) and Juan Neves-Sarriegui (University of Oxford). 

The series accompanies a virtual special issue of Past & Present on 'Capitalism in Global History' which is due to be published soon.

In connection with the virtual special issue, the group is also running a series of online 'Capitalism in Global History' virtual workshops which include:

Thursday 26 November, 5pm - Prof. Maxine Berg (University of Warwick): Capitalism in Global History, articles from the virtual issue and elsewhere

Tuesday 8 December, 5pm - Prof. Joanna Innes (University of Oxford): Political Economy and Culture in Global History, series of blog posts
